Also known as: Tetradecanamide, N-(3-(dimethylamino)propyl)-, phosphate (1:1), Katemul MP-80 amido-amine salt
CAS 129541-40-8
Myristamidopropyl dimethylamine phosphate (CAS 129541-40-8) is a chemical substance. Key regulatory status: 1 regulatory/inventory list, cosmetic ingredient cross-reference; source data from EPA ToxValDB, EPA CPDat.
